Defining "Near Me": Tailoring Your Search

The phrase "near me" is subjective. To effectively plan your dog-friendly vacation, you need to define your radius. Consider:

  • Driving Distance: How far are you willing to drive? A shorter drive minimizes travel stress for both you and your dog.
  • Travel Time: Factor in potential traffic delays, especially during peak seasons.
  • Your Dog's Needs: Is your dog comfortable with long car rides? Consider shorter trips if your dog has anxiety or health concerns.
  • Accommodation Preferences: Are you looking for a rural retreat, a bustling city break, or something in between? This will help narrow down your search area.

Types of Dog-Friendly Vacations Near You: A Diverse Range of Options

The possibilities for dog-friendly vacations are vast and varied. Here are some popular choices:

1. Coastal Escapes: Many beaches welcome well-behaved dogs, offering opportunities for walks, fetch, and enjoying the sea breeze. Remember to check local regulations regarding leash laws and designated dog-friendly areas. Look for pet-friendly accommodations near the beach, offering easy access to sandy shores.

2. Mountain Getaways: Hiking trails in mountain regions offer breathtaking scenery and invigorating exercise for both you and your dog. Ensure the trails are dog-friendly and appropriate for your dog's fitness level. Cozy cabins nestled in the mountains provide a relaxing retreat after a day of exploring.

3. Rural Retreats: Farm stays, ranches, and countryside cottages often welcome dogs, providing a tranquil setting away from the hustle and bustle of city life. Your dog might even enjoy meeting farm animals! These locations often boast spacious grounds for your dog to roam freely.

4. National and State Parks: Several national and state parks allow dogs on designated trails and in specific areas. Remember to research park regulations thoroughly before your visit and pack essentials like water bowls, poop bags, and leashes. Be aware of wildlife and potential hazards on the trails.

5. City Breaks: Surprisingly, many cities offer dog-friendly attractions and accommodations. Look for pet-friendly hotels, restaurants with outdoor seating, and parks with designated off-leash areas. Plan your itinerary around dog-friendly activities and be mindful of city noise and crowds.

Finding Dog-Friendly Accommodations: Essential Considerations

Finding the right accommodation is crucial for a successful dog-friendly vacation. Consider these factors:

  • Pet Policies: Carefully review the hotel's, cabin's, or rental's pet policy. Check for any breed restrictions, size limits, or additional fees.
  • Amenities: Look for accommodations with amenities that cater to both you and your dog, such as dog beds, bowls, and nearby dog parks or walking trails.
  • Location: Choose a location that offers easy access to dog-friendly activities and attractions.
  • Reviews: Read reviews from other pet owners to get insights into their experiences and ensure the accommodation is truly dog-friendly.
  • Booking Platforms: Use online booking platforms that filter for pet-friendly accommodations.

Safety First: Essential Tips for a Safe Dog-Friendly Vacation

Safety is key when traveling with your dog. Remember to:

  • Identification: Ensure your dog has proper identification tags with your contact information. Consider microchipping for added security.
  • Leash Laws: Always adhere to local leash laws and keep your dog on a leash unless in designated off-leash areas.
  • Heat Precautions: Avoid strenuous activities during the hottest parts of the day, and provide plenty of shade and water.
  • Car Safety: Secure your dog in a pet carrier or with a seatbelt harness during car rides.
  • Emergency Preparedness: Pack a first-aid kit for your dog and know the location of the nearest veterinary clinic.

Budgeting for Your Dog-Friendly Trip: Unexpected Costs

While planning your budget, remember to factor in costs related to your dog:

  • Pet Fees: Many accommodations charge additional fees for pets.
  • Food and Treats: Purchase enough food and treats to last the duration of your trip.
  • Veterinary Care: Set aside some money for unexpected veterinary expenses.
  • Pet Supplies: Replenish any supplies you might need during your trip.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How do I find dog-friendly restaurants near me?

A: Use online search engines, review sites, and dedicated pet-friendly apps to locate restaurants with outdoor seating that welcome dogs. Always call ahead to confirm their pet policy.

Q: What should I pack for my dog on vacation?

A: Pack food, water, bowls, leash, collar, poop bags, favorite toys, bedding, any necessary medications, and a first-aid kit.

Q: Are there any dog-friendly national parks near me?

A: Many national parks allow dogs on designated trails and in specific areas. Check the park's website for detailed information on pet policies and restrictions.

Q: What if my dog gets lost during vacation?

A: Ensure your dog is wearing proper identification tags and is microchipped. Report your dog missing to local authorities and animal shelters immediately.

Q: How do I handle my dog's anxiety during travel?

A: Consult your veterinarian for advice on managing your dog's anxiety. Here's the thing — consider using calming aids or pheromone diffusers. Plan frequent stops during long car rides to allow your dog to stretch and relieve themselves.
